Was Mary in the workhouse as a pauper? Or did her family already work there, hence that her address at death? Or often workhouses were also the local hospitals, so she could have died there but never have been admitted as a pauper.

Not sure what you are meaning here, Lambeth is London
London is normally classified as Middlesex north of the Thames & Surrey south of the Thames. It is really only 'the square mile' that is the City of London.
